Thanks for the invite Fridge, not really sure, I'm able to pull off such a Gig yet, although, I've dreamed of such.
I drove out to Alaska in 1976. We did it mostly for the drive, and I didn't even get to see any of the interior.
The drive alone was great though, well, it was, once we got into Northern BC, and then into the Yukon.
I'll never forget catching Grayling, like Bluegill, one after another, and this was right off the Hwy. too.
I remember driving past Wrangell St Elias, and wondering which peak was Mt. Logan. All the high peaks were covered in snow, and was quite a site, it looked like you could almost reach out and touch them, right from the Alaskan Hwy.
